Giraffe Centre Nairobi: Your Ultimate Guide to Visiting
Embark on an extraordinary adventure at the Giraffe Centre Nairobi, a remarkable nature centre Nairobi dedicated to the conservation of the endangered Rothschild giraffe Kenya. Situated in the tranquil Lang’ata suburb, this sanctuary, run by the esteemed African Fund for Endangered Wildlife (AFEW), provides a unique opportunity for visitors to connect intimately with these gentle giants while contributing to vital wildlife conservation Nairobi efforts.

- Distinguishing the Experience: Giraffe Centre vs. Giraffe Manor Nairobi: While both locations offer giraffe encounters, it’s essential to understand the difference. The Giraffe Manor Nairobi is an exclusive boutique hotel, whereas the Giraffe Centre Nairobi is primarily a non-profit conservation and education facility welcoming the public.

Planning Your Visit: Practical Tips
To ensure a smooth and enjoyable experience at this exceptional giraffe sanctuary Nairobi, consider the following details:
- Giraffe Centre Nairobi entrance fee: An admission fee applies, and these funds are directly reinvested into the centre’s crucial conservation programs. It’s advisable to check their official website for the most current entrance fee information. For the year 2025, the fee is USD 15 per adult while a child pays 50% of adult rate.
- Giraffe Centre Nairobi opening hours: The centre typically welcomes visitors daily, but verifying the precise opening hours before your trip is recommended to avoid any inconvenience. Generally, the opening hours are from 9 am to 5 pm every day.
- Giraffe Centre Nairobi location: Situated conveniently in the Lang’ata area of Nairobi, the centre is easily reachable by taxi services or personal transportation.
